How hard can it be to drive coast-to-coast across Britain on one tank of fuel, they asked? Not very, we said. So we topped up, left Great Yarmouth on the east coast of England and headed on a road trip to Anglesey on the west coast of Wales. The idea was simple: drive across the UK and splurge all the leftover petrol on some hot laps of the Anglesey race circuit.

Our job was made easier by being in a Toyota Auris Hybrid, the only volume hybrid car manufactured in Britain and one theoretically capable of travelling more than 70 miles on every gallon of petrol. And to make us eke out every last drop, we brought along one of Britain’s hyper-miling experts Karl Dyson to teach us some eco-driving tips.
